Query 2,400 castles, fortresses and palaces across 131 countries (coordinates, founding dates, fame ranking, Wikipedia summaries) from the open CC0 Castlemap dataset built on Wikidata. Hosted endpoint needs no API key; the zero-dependency server can also be self-hosted.
Cities, countries, regions, and languages with multilingual names (50 languages) and a free keyless autocomplete tool. Also runs a public hosted instance at https://mcp.geomelon.dev/mcp, no signup required.

Castlemap MCP Tools (7)
search_castles
Find castles by name, country or category
get_castle
Full record for one castle
castles_near
Nearest castles to a coordinate (haversine); geocode first
top_castles
Best-known castles, by fame rank
list_countries
The 141 countries, with counts
get_statistics
Live aggregates — totals, per-country, per-century
